I use a HRAP EX 360, HRAP VX 360 and HRAP4 PS3/PS4 and all of them are slightly muddled in telling where your inputs are. They are still very good sticks, but with the SF x TK sticks I can tell when I do inputs spot on or just off. It feels crisper IMO.

I actually want to mod the HRAPVX (Possibly also the HRAPEX) with a PS360+ board so I can make sticks for Dreamcast and PS2 if friends come over. The problem I've had is everybody is sold out of PS360+ right now. That sucks because I have been really happy with the PS360+ since I got it installed.
